Compensation for Economic Losses

The most common method to pay medical bills and other losses you experience after a car accident is by receiving settlement. The amount you receive depends on several factors such as the extent of your injuries and the time it could be to treat.

You could also be entitled to compensation for amount you have lost due to your injuries prevented you from working and from engaging in other activities or hobbies you enjoyed prior to your accident. Insurance companies may ask for documentation of these expenses and a letter from your doctor that explains how your injuries have affected your.

Non-economic damages, such as pain and suffering are more difficult to quantify than quantifiable expenses like medical expenses or lost wages. To make up for these intangible losses the insurance company typically uses a multiplier based on medical expenses. The more severe your injuries, the more the multiplier.

New York does not limit the amount you are entitled to in damages for suffering and pain. However many states do. If you are seeking compensation for your non-economic losses, a reputable lawyer can assist you to comprehend what the insurance company offers and ensure you receive all of the compensation you're entitled to.

Compensation for non-economic losses

Non-economic damages are more difficult to estimate. They could include emotional suffering and pain, the loss of enjoyment due to the inability to participate in your favorite hobbies or leisure activities or even the loss of a relationship when you're married, and even a disfigurement. A knowledgeable attorney can assist you in determining the exact amount of your non-economic damage and ensure you receive fair compensation for them.

To maximize your settlement, ensure you have the most complete and complete medical evidence of your injuries. This includes a police report, medical reports from all medical professionals who treat you following the accident, photographs of your injuries, as well as damage to your vehicle, as well as any other evidence that could help you prove your claim. Making copies, both digital and physical of all these documents can help speed up the settlement process.

In addition to your economic and non-economic damages, you may also be entitled to punitive damages. These are designed to punish the person who was at fault for the most egregious or reckless behavior and to deter future similar behavior. They are not usually a part of a settlement in a car accident but you may be awarded them if a jury determines that the driver at fault did something wrong or intentionally caused your injuries.
